Transaction 803557275a78071162a82a72feae64bba9ba0bd073bd198d9afcf27645e5ec35
1 Input
1 Output
-
803557275a78071162a82a72feae64bba9ba0bd073bd198d9afcf27645e5ec35:0
- value
- 3425959
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 90108801ca140bd332e2d5f21dab1e16d106f2e9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1E8k7Ejp1nnK5mK6xboXLifn1qftCv3Ufi